Best Brunches On Retro Row
In the midst of an eclectic community nestled on a row of vintage shops and coffee houses, Long Beach’s 4th Street is most commonly referred to as “Retro Row”. Known for an abundance of vintage shops and thrift stores, the row also has an abundance of the most unique and farm fresh coffee houses and cafes ideal for the perfect friendly brunch! RESTAURATION
2708 E. 4th Street in Long Beach
Theme: Restauration is a combination of two defining pillars of the Long Beach community: restaurant+restore
Food: Menus are seasonal! The food is locally sourced and responsibly grown, using seasonal ingredients based on the abundant bounty available on the Southern and Central Coast. Many options on the menu are served family style intended for sharing. They have craft beer on draft and in large bottles from all over the world! They also have a wine list that highlights small producers from California and other unique wine growing regions from afar.
Aesthetic: The interior and exterior have a majority rustic aesthetic complimented by earthy tones with wood benches and tables and an abundance of greenery in the back! With repurposed lighting, handmade tables & benches, a 50-seat fire lit patio encircled with vertical gardens, Restauration creates a warm and refreshing environment for all!

PORTFOLIO COFFEE HOUSE
2300 East Fourth Street
Long Beach, CA 90814
As probably Retro Row’s Finest Coffee House, Portfolio hosts Stumptown Coffee, Art by local artists, Vinyl Nights, live music from local bands and even Sunday Vegan Brunch! Their coffee is personally my favorite and I love the diverse community the coffee house warmly welcomes!

THE SOCIAL LIST
2105 E. 4TH STREET
LONG BEACH CA, 90814
Theme: Their motto is to create “fresh, locally sourced, delicious food” in an enjoyable family friendly and social environment.
Food: They specialize in creating comfort food in small shared plates, seasonal sandwiches, salads, and entrées, as well as a wide selection of craft beer, wine, and spirits! Their happy hour has the best deals ranging from Tallboy Tuesdays and Wine Wednesdays!
Aesthetic: With art by local artists and a rustic interior, the Social List creates a overall European-style tavern filled with long wooden tables and steel stools surrounded by comfortable and close booths!
